Mohsen Mahdawi (Arabic: محسن المهداوي) is a Palestinian activist and student at Columbia University's School of General Studies. Mahdawi was among a number of student activists targeted by the Trump administration for deportation. After ten years as a permanent resident of the United States, he arrived for an interview to obtain U.S. citizenship at the U.S. Citizenship and Immigration Services (USCIS) office in Colchester, Vermont on April 14, 2025, when he was arrested and detained by U.S. Immigration and Customs Enforcement (ICE) agents. He was subsequently granted release under habeas corpus, pending adjudication of the merits of the case in support of his deportation.
